The safest way to thaw meat is by transferring it from the freezer to the refrigerator and allowing it to thaw there.
The next best way is to place the frozen meat in cold water to thaw, changing the water every 30 minutes until it is thawed.

The safest way to defrost meat is to allow it to thaw in the refrigerator. This takes a long time, usually over night, but it keeps the meat the meat at a safe temperature and prevents bacteria growth. This is the best way to thaw meat that will be eaten raw or undercooked. Another safe method is to place the wrapped meat in a bowl in the sink and keep continuous cold water running over it. You'll need to flip the meat several times for even thawing. Thawing meat in the microwave is another option, but only if the meat is going to be thoroughly cooked.

It isn't safe to thaw any meat at room temperature because the meat will warm up unevenly and bacterial load will increase more on the warmest spots. You can't be certain which bacteria they are and cooking might not kill them all off.
